How Custom Fabrication Enhances Product Performance in Aerospace

product performance in aerospace

Precision, reliability, and efficiency are critical in aerospace manufacturing. Every component must perform under extreme conditions, from intense pressure changes to high-speed flight. Standardized parts may work in some applications, but when it comes to optimizing product performance, reducing weight, and ensuring maximum durability, custom fabrication is the key to success.

Optimizing Strength Without Excess Weight

Aerospace engineering demands materials with the highest strength and the lowest possible weight. Custom fabrication allows manufacturers to tailor materials and designs to meet these exacting standards. Using advanced alloys such as titanium, aluminum, and high-strength stainless steel, engineers can create components that withstand extreme forces while keeping aircraft light and fuel-efficient. Weight reduction is not just about improving performance—it directly impacts fuel consumption, cost efficiency, and overall sustainability.

Precision Engineering for Maximum Reliability and Product Performance

Every aerospace component must meet strict tolerances to function correctly. Even the slightest deviation can lead to mechanical failures or inefficiencies that compromise safety. Custom fabrication ensures that each part is manufactured precisely, using processes such as CNC machining, laser cutting, and advanced welding techniques. Whether it’s an aircraft frame, engine component, or structural fastener, precision manufacturing minimizes the risk of weak points, ensuring the highest level of reliability in flight.

Enhanced Corrosion and Heat Resistance

Aircraft are constantly exposed to harsh environments, including temperature extremes, high humidity, and corrosive elements. Custom fabrication enables manufacturers to apply specialized coatings and treatments that enhance corrosion resistance, thermal stability, and wear protection. Processes such as anodizing for aluminum components, heat treatments for steel alloys, and ceramic coatings for high-temperature applications extend the lifespan of critical aerospace parts. These enhancements improve durability and reduce long-term maintenance and replacement costs.

Custom Tooling and Prototyping for Faster Development

The aerospace industry is constantly evolving, with advancements in materials, aerodynamics, and propulsion systems requiring rapid innovation. Custom fabrication plays a crucial role in accelerating the development process through specialized tooling and prototyping. Instead of relying on mass-produced parts that may not meet exact specifications, manufacturers can use custom molds, jigs, and fixtures to produce components tailored to specific design needs. This approach not only improves the performance of final products but also speeds up testing and validation phases. With rapid prototyping techniques such as additive manufacturing, engineers can quickly refine designs, identify potential weaknesses, and make adjustments before full-scale production begins.

Design Flexibility for Innovative Solutions

Aerospace innovation depends on the ability to push boundaries in design. Custom fabrication allows engineers to develop complex geometries, lightweight structures, and aerodynamically optimized components that would be impossible with standard manufacturing methods. Additive manufacturing, or 3D metal printing, has further expanded possibilities by enabling the production of intricate, high-strength parts with reduced material waste. This flexibility supports the development of next-generation aircraft and spacecraft with improved efficiency and performance.
